Looks like the No. 65. This page from a 1932 Husqvarna catalog --
No. 65 .22 LR Rifle.jpeg
There were two cheaper versions of this little bolt action also. The No. 65 remains in a 1949 Husqvarna catalog I have but is gone from a mid 1950s catalog.
